In the rapidly evolving landscape of healthcare in Indonesia, the importance of equipping medical personnel with digital skills cannot be overstated. Training programs have been developed to support healthcare professionals in adapting to and embracing modern healthcare practices that are heavily reliant on digital technologies.

Importance of Digital Skills Development

The integration of digital tools and technologies in healthcare has revolutionized the way medical services are delivered, managed, and optimized. Medical personnel need to acquire digital skills to effectively leverage these technologies for improved patient care, operational efficiency, and decision-making.

Training Programs

1. Digital Health Literacy:
This program focuses on enhancing medical professionals’ understanding of digital health concepts, including electronic health records (EHR), telemedicine, health information systems, and data analytics. Participants learn how to navigate digital platforms and interpret health data to make informed decisions.

2. Electronic Medical Record (EMR) Systems Training:
Medical personnel are trained to use EMR systems for efficient documentation, storage, and retrieval of patient information. They learn how to input data accurately, maintain confidentiality, and use EMR features to streamline clinical workflows.

3. Telemedicine and Remote Patient Monitoring:
This program teaches healthcare providers how to conduct virtual consultations, monitor patients remotely, and use telehealth platforms for diagnosis, treatment, and follow-up care. Medical personnel are trained to ensure the security and privacy of patient data during remote interactions.

4. Health Information Management (HIM) Training:
Medical professionals undergo training in HIM practices to effectively manage healthcare data, ensure data integrity, and comply with regulatory requirements. They learn how to use HIM systems for coding, billing, and reporting purposes, contributing to efficient healthcare operations.

Benefits of Digital Skills Development

  • Enhanced Patient Care: Medical personnel equipped with digital skills can deliver personalized and timely care to patients, leading to improved health outcomes and patient satisfaction.
  • Operational Efficiency: Digital skills enable healthcare providers to automate processes, reduce paperwork, and optimize resource allocation, resulting in cost savings and increased productivity.
  • Data-Driven Decision Making: Proficiency in digital technologies empowers medical professionals to analyze health data, identify trends, and make evidence-based decisions that drive continuous improvement in healthcare delivery.
